Understanding the Incident
Russian fighter jets briefly violated Estonian airspace on Saturday, September 20th.Estonian authorities quickly identified and tracked the aircraft, scrambling their own air defense assets in response. While the incursion was relatively brief, it represents a significant escalation in regional tensions.
Here’s what makes this event particularly noteworthy:
* Estonia is a NATO member. An attack on Estonian airspace is, thus, considered a potential attack on the entire alliance.
* It follows a pattern of increased Russian military activity. Over the past year, there’s been a documented rise in probing flights and exercises near NATO borders.
* The timing is sensitive. With ongoing conflicts elsewhere in europe, this incident adds another layer of complexity to an already volatile security landscape.

What Happens Next?
The immediate aftermath of the airspace violation has involved diplomatic protests from estonia and expressions of solidarity from NATO allies. However, the long-term implications remain uncertain.
Here are some potential scenarios to consider:
- Increased NATO surveillance: Expect heightened monitoring of Russian military activity in the region.
- Strengthened air defenses: Estonia and neighboring countries may request additional air defense capabilities from NATO.
- Diplomatic efforts: Back-channel communications between major powers could be initiated to de-escalate tensions.
- Further provocations: Unluckily, there’s a risk of Russia conducting similar incursions to test NATO’s resolve.
